What is a dry cooler?

How Does It Work?

The working principle is straightforward:

  1. Hot fluid (e.g., a glycol solution) flows inside finned tubes within the unit.

  2. External air is forced over these tubes by fans, or flows across them naturally.

  3. Heat exchange occurs between the air and the fluid: the air absorbs the heat, thereby reducing the temperature of the fluid inside the tubes.

Main Application Areas

Due to their energy efficiency and water-saving design, dry coolers are widely used in various fields:

  • Data Centers: As a core component of energy-efficient HVAC systems, they utilize natural outdoor cooling sources to cool server rooms, significantly reducing energy consumption.

  • Industrial Cooling: Used to cool equipment in power plants, petrochemical facilities, pharmaceutical manufacturing, and more.

  • Commercial Refrigeration: Applied in refrigeration systems for large supermarkets, warehouses, and distribution centers.

  • HVAC Systems: Used in conjunction with chillers or in "free cooling" systems to replace part of the mechanical cooling during intermediate seasons or winter.

  • Industrial Heat Treatment: In specialized processes (like vacuum furnaces), they provide clean, closed-loop circulating cooling to protect critical equipment.

Common Types & Key Features

Dry coolers come in various designs and specifications to suit different needs:

  • Structure: Depending on installation space and heat dissipation requirements, they can be designed for horizontal or vertical airflow, and in flat-bed or V-shaped configurations.

  • Core Components: The critical part is the coil, typically made of copper tubes with high-efficiency aluminum fins, offering good heat transfer and corrosion resistance.

  • Key Options: They can be equipped with EC energy-saving fans, anti-corrosion coatings, adiabatic spray systems (for auxiliary cooling during high summer temperatures), and free-cooling valve packages.

  • Performance Range: The cooling capacity of these products varies widely, from small units around 10kW to large industrial units up to 2000kW.
